Blog Action Day . In honor of this I have selected this excerpt from the announcement for their latest initiative: " Leaders... are not planning to do enough to to avert the climate crisis. But we can change that -- with one number, and one day. The number is 350, and it's now the most important number on the planet. 350 is the number that leading scientists say is the safe upper limit for carbon dioxide in our atmosphere, measured in parts per million. -- Eco-Event -- Recycling Council of Alberta - 2009 Waste Reduction Conference When: Oct 14-16 Location: Calgary AB Info: www.recycle.ab.ca -- Recycling in Canada (2004) -- *Source: Recycling Product News Magazine - www.baumpub.com Statistics Canada’s 2004 Census numbers show that across the country about 27 % of waste is recycled – about 112 kilograms per capita. British Columbia has always been a leader in Canada – the 2004 Census found that 37.7 % of waste was diverted in B.C. The largest city in BC, Vancouver reached more than 50 % diversion from the landfill through waste reduction efforts.
